CachedFileUpdaterTriggerDetails.CanRequestUserInput 屬性

定義

取得系統是否可以顯示 UI,允許使用者啟動提供者應用程式,以回應快取的檔案更新程式觸發程式。

public:
 property bool CanRequestUserInput { bool get(); };
bool CanRequestUserInput();
public bool CanRequestUserInput { get; }
var boolean = cachedFileUpdaterTriggerDetails.canRequestUserInput;
Public ReadOnly Property CanRequestUserInput As Boolean

屬性值

Boolean

bool

系統是否可以顯示允許使用者啟動提供者應用程式的 UI,以回應快取的檔案更新程式觸發程式。

備註

快取檔案更新程式模式可讓提供者應用程式藉由將相關聯FileUpdateRequestStatus屬性設定為UserInputNeeded,指定需要使用者輸入才能完成快取的檔案更新。 例如,如果更新檔案的應用程式目前未在前景執行,系統可能無法在背景工作期間向使用者顯示 UI。 在此情況下,CanRequestUserInput 會是 false。 因此,您應該先檢查此值,再要求系統顯示 UI。 如果 CanRequestUserInput 為 false,將 FileUpdateRequest 狀態設定為 UserInputNeeded 將會擲回例外狀況。

適用於